The Chronicles of Narnia: Prince Caspian (3 Disc)The Chronicles of Narnia: Prince Caspian is the latest big Blu-ray title from Walt Disney Studios Home Entertainment, scheduled for a December 2nd release.

This title is of course the second in the Chronicles of Narnia series.

The Chronicles of Narnia: Prince Caspian was directed by Andrew Adamson, who not only directed the first movie in the series, The Chronicles of Narnia: The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e, but also the Shrek series for DreamWorks.

The movie faired pretty well with the critics, earning a Rotten Tomatoes score of 66% and IMDb score of 7.2/10.

Prince Caspian was also a strong performer in the cinema, making over $140M at the US box office.

scene.jpgThe video on the disc is an AVC 1080p encode at 19 Mbps, and is presented in its original aspect ratio of 2.40:1.

The main audio is lossless DTS-HD Master Audio with 7.1 channels - 24 bits resolution at 48 kHz.

I am very pleased to see Disney moving towards 7.1 channel sound tracks for movie releases - I hope that this trend, which started with The Nightmare Before Christmas, will continue.

The disc is a dual layer BD50, with 48.7 GB used and is coded for Region A.

narniamenu.jpgSpecial features are numerous and include BD Live Network features and a Digital Copy.

Expect an audio commentary from the film makers and cast, as well as behind the scenes featurettes with cast and crew interviews, a tour of the sets and locations and a view inside the technology used to make the film.

circlevision.jpgThe Circle-Vision feature on the first disc uses the 360 degree HDRI camera castle images as the background for menus that cover many segments showing behind the scenes details of almost every aspect of the night castle raid sequence.

The segments cover a lot of the organization, technology and hard work that goes into making the scenes.

narniamenud2.jpgOver to the second disc, which is dedicated to supplements, fans of film making ‘gone wrong’ will enjoy the blooper reel, and there is also a deleted scenes segment with introduction from the director.

The second disc also contains many featurettes, covering the making of the second installment, the book to movie translation, the effect of the movie on the locations they shot in, the ‘pre-visualizing’ tools used to help create scenes, the creation of the creatures and effects shots, how the duel scene was shot and how actors were transformed into their fantasy world characters.

Synopsis:

In The Chronicles of Narnia: Prince Caspian, the Pevensie children face a perilous mission and a greater test of their faith and courage. They find a world in which 1,300 years have passed. The White Witch is gone, the realm is ruled by a cruel tyrant and Aslan has been missing for over a thousand years. The four children embark on a remarkable journey to restore magic and glory to the land. Accompanied by Trumpkin, a valiant dwarf, Reepicheep the talking mouse and a suspicious Black Dwarf named Nikabrik, they raise an army of Narnians to rise up against the evil king Miraz.
